use super::syntax_kind::SyntaxKind;
use logos::Logos;
use rowan::TextSize;
#[derive(Debug, Clone, PartialEq, Eq)]
pub struct Token<'a> {
pub kind: SyntaxKind,
pub text: &'a str,
pub offset: TextSize,
}
pub struct Lexer<'a> {
inner: logos::Lexer<'a, LogosToken>,
offset: u32,
}
impl<'a> Lexer<'a> {
pub fn new(input: &'a str) -> Self {
Self {
inner: LogosToken::lexer(input),
offset: 0,
}
}
}
impl<'a> Iterator for Lexer<'a> {
type Item = Token<'a>;
fn next(&mut self) -> Option<Self::Item> {
let logos_token = self.inner.next()?;
let text = self.inner.slice();
let offset = TextSize::new(self.offset);
self.offset += text.len() as u32;
let kind = match logos_token {
Ok(t) => t.into(),
Err(()) => SyntaxKind::ERROR,
};
Some(Token { kind, text, offset })
}
}
#[allow(dead_code)]
pub fn tokenize(input: &str) -> Vec<Token<'_>> {
Lexer::new(input).collect()
}

#[cfg(test)]
mod tests {
use super::*;
#[test]
fn test_lex_package() {
let tokens: Vec<_> = Lexer::new("package Test;").collect();
assert_eq!(tokens.len(), 4); assert_eq!(tokens[0].kind, SyntaxKind::PACKAGE_KW);
assert_eq!(tokens[1].kind, SyntaxKind::WHITESPACE);
assert_eq!(tokens[2].kind, SyntaxKind::IDENT);
assert_eq!(tokens[3].kind, SyntaxKind::SEMICOLON);
}
#[test]
fn test_lex_qualified_name() {
let tokens: Vec<_> = Lexer::new("A::B::C").collect();
assert_eq!(tokens[0].kind, SyntaxKind::IDENT);
assert_eq!(tokens[1].kind, SyntaxKind::COLON_COLON);
assert_eq!(tokens[2].kind, SyntaxKind::IDENT);
assert_eq!(tokens[3].kind, SyntaxKind::COLON_COLON);
assert_eq!(tokens[4].kind, SyntaxKind::IDENT);
}
#[test]
fn test_lex_specializes() {
let tokens: Vec<_> = Lexer::new("part def A :> B;").collect();
let kinds: Vec<_> = tokens.iter().map(|t| t.kind).collect();
assert!(kinds.contains(&SyntaxKind::PART_KW));
assert!(kinds.contains(&SyntaxKind::DEF_KW));
assert!(kinds.contains(&SyntaxKind::COLON_GT));
}
#[test]
fn test_lex_comment() {
let tokens: Vec<_> = Lexer::new("// comment\npackage").collect();
assert_eq!(tokens[0].kind, SyntaxKind::LINE_COMMENT);
assert_eq!(tokens[1].kind, SyntaxKind::WHITESPACE);
assert_eq!(tokens[2].kind, SyntaxKind::PACKAGE_KW);
}
#[test]
fn test_lex_import_wildcard() {
let tokens: Vec<_> = Lexer::new("import ISQ::*;").collect();
let kinds: Vec<_> = tokens.iter().map(|t| t.kind).collect();
assert!(kinds.contains(&SyntaxKind::IMPORT_KW));
assert!(kinds.contains(&SyntaxKind::COLON_COLON));
assert!(kinds.contains(&SyntaxKind::STAR));
assert!(kinds.contains(&SyntaxKind::SEMICOLON));
}
}
